Walter Donaldson’s timeless Tin Pan Alley classic, "My Mammy"—forever cemented in American popular culture by Al Jolson’s landmark 1920 recordings and early sound film appearances—originates from an era when vaudeville and early jazz were rapidly intertwining. Written collaboratively with lyricists Sam M. Lewis and Joe Young, the song became an instant crossover hit, later being reinterpreted through the decades by jazz and swing luminaries including Count Basie, Fats Waller, and Judy Garland. Executing John Farley’s arrangement of "My Mammy" successfully requires a disciplined approach to swing articulation and dynamic contrast. The tempo should be anchored at a comfortable, driving medium-swing (approx. 120–126 BPM), ensuring the eighth notes remain evenly spaced and never lapse into an overly lazy or triplet-heavy lurch. The rhythm section is the engine here: the pianist should deploy crisp, comping shell voicings that leave plenty of space, while the drummer maintains a steady, feather-light ride cymbal pulse with a crisp two-and-four hi-hat chick. Horn players must pay close attention to marked accents and dynamic hairpins, particularly during the ensemble soli sections where balance is paramount. Utilize subtle plunger mutes or cup mutes in the trumpet and trombone sections during the intro to capture that authentic vintage tone before opening up for the main theme. Rehearsals should initially focus on sectional isolation of the counterpoint lines before integrating the rhythm section to lock in the groove.
